Prestige Nursing East Lancashire is looking for new members to join our growing team supporting individuals within their own homes and care settings. Experience of working in care is preferred, but not essential; however, you will require access to your own vehicle if completing day shifts β mileage is paid. We need compassionate, committed, caring staff to support our service users across the region.
We provide all new members with our mandatory training programme, and further client-specific training where necessary. We offer our members a variety of work patterns with service users on care routes throughout Accrington, Blackburn, Burnley, Colne, Darwen, Nelson, and surrounding areas. You will require access to your own vehicle and a full UK driving licence.
The Role
- Personal care tasks; including washing and toileting
- Administering medication
- Encouraging diet and fluid intake
- Promoting independence
- Completing documentation to a high standard
- Using Prestige's call monitoring service

β¨Tip Number 1
Get to know the company! Before your interview, do a bit of research on Prestige Nursing East Lancashire. Understand their values and what they stand for. This will help you connect with them during the chat and show that you're genuinely interested in being part of their team.
β¨Tip Number 2
Practice makes perfect! Run through common interview questions with a friend or family member. Think about how your experiences, even if they're not directly in care, can relate to the role of a Healthcare Assistant. Confidence is key!
β¨Tip Number 3
Dress to impress! Even though itβs a care role, showing up looking smart and professional can make a great first impression. It shows that you respect the opportunity and are serious about joining the team.
β¨Tip Number 4
Follow up after your interview! A quick thank-you email can go a long way. It shows your appreciation for the opportunity and keeps you fresh in their minds. Plus, itβs a chance to reiterate your enthusiasm for the role!

How to prepare for a job interview at Prestige Nursing
β¨Know Your Role
Before the interview, make sure you understand the responsibilities of a Healthcare Assistant. Familiarise yourself with tasks like personal care, administering medication, and promoting independence. This will help you demonstrate your knowledge and show that you're genuinely interested in the role.
β¨Show Your Compassion
In the healthcare field, compassion is key. Think of examples from your past experiences where you've shown empathy or helped someone in need. Be ready to share these stories during the interview to highlight your caring nature.
β¨Prepare Questions
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the company culture, training opportunities, and work patterns. This shows that you're engaged and serious about finding the right fit for both you and the company.
β¨Dress for Success
Even if the role is hands-on, first impressions matter. Dress smartly for your interview to convey professionalism. A neat appearance can set a positive tone and show that you respect the opportunity to join their team.
